Oumingzhuang Biological Technology (OMZ) has installed a valve solution from GF Piping Systems in the construction of the latest generation of its ion exchangers. This installation aims to reduce wastewater discharge and increase efficiency. Based in Tianjin, the company specializes in process technology used in bioplastic production.
In 2020, OMZ seized the opportunity to further expand the volume and efficiency of the 5th generation of its ion exchangers, with the goal of reducing water usage and wastewater discharge for its clients. Technical solutions were required that guarantee high reliability in acidic environments and can be integrated into a modern automation system.
OMZ and GF Piping Systems installed 5,000 valves during the project across seven parallel ion exchangers. By using DN50 valves, it was possible to implement smaller dimensions while maintaining the same flow performance, allowing OMZ to reduce the size and weight of the installations. Once installed, the valves achieved higher efficiency, a 40% reduction in wastewater discharge, and a 30% increase in resin material usage.
